A top-rated nursing home is about much more than just a high star rating from Medicare, though that is an excellent starting point. For families in Hawaii, it's about finding a place that feels like *ohana* and understands the specific needs of our kupuna. The tropical climate and island lifestyle mean that considerations like indoor-outdoor living, access to fresh air, and activities that reflect local culture are not just amenities—they are essential for well-being. When researching facilities in Hilo, which is the closest major center to Ninole, look for those that incorporate garden spaces, offer Hawaiian music or hula, and serve locally sourced foods when possible. These elements contribute profoundly to a resident's sense of home and connection.
Your research should be multi-faceted. Begin with the official Medicare.gov "Nursing Home Compare" website, which provides detailed inspection reports, staffing data, and quality measures. Pay close attention to staffing levels, as consistent, sufficient staffing is the backbone of good care. However, don't stop at the data. The most crucial step is the in-person visit, and you should plan to visit any potential facility more than once, ideally at different times of the day. Observe how staff interact with residents—is it with patience and respect? Do the residents appear engaged and comfortable? Trust your instincts and your senses; a clean, odor-free environment is a basic but vital indicator.
Remember that your role as an advocate is continuous. Prepare a list of questions about care plans, how medical emergencies are handled, and the facility's approach to managing specific conditions your loved one may have. Inquire about transportation for medical appointments, as travel to specialists often requires going to Hilo or even Kona. Also, consider the practicalities for your family. While the focus is on your loved one's needs, choosing a facility within a reasonable driving distance from Ninole will make regular visits and involvement in care meetings far more sustainable, strengthening that essential family bond.
Finally, tap into local knowledge. Speak with your loved one's doctors, hospital social workers in Hilo, and community groups. They often have invaluable insights into the reputations and specialties of different facilities.
